- 197 Episodes (2008-2009). Flora was imprisoned for 18 years for the murder of the lover, Marcelo. She has always pleaded not guilty, and now that her sentence is finished, she wants revenge. Her main target is Donatella, her former partner in a country music duo and the widow of Marcelo. Flora blames Donatella not only for killing her own husband, but also for taking away Lara, the daughter Flora had with the killed man. In the meantime, Lara grows aware that her natural mother is a murderer and cares for Donatella as her actual mom, despite having a strong temper and very different personality. Everything is set in a small town nearby São Paulo, where the main powerful figure is that of Gonçalo Fontini, Marcelo's father and owner of a paper-mill plant.
